Specifications
Payout Split100% on first $25,000 lifetime profits, then 90/10100% of first $10,000 in profit, then 80% (Core/Pro) or 90% (Rapid)
Max Funded$300,000 (up to 20 accounts simultaneously)$150,000
Payout Cap$4,000/payout at step 6 on $100K EOD. Account closes after 6 payouts — new eval required.$100,000 cumulative per account; no monthly cap
Drawdown ModelEOD Trailing — ratchets up with peak end-of-day balance, closed balance basisEOD trailing — balance-based (closed end-of-day balance)
Min Days5 qualifying days per payout cycle (each day must hit minimum daily profit threshold)Plan-dependent
Challenge FeeOne-time: ~$399 eval + $139 PA activation ($538 total on $100K EOD). Frequent 70-90% discount periods.Core from $77/mo; Rapid from $129/mo; Pro from $229/mo
Fee RefundableNo — one-time fee, not refunded on first payoutNo — subscription model. No activation fees on funded transition.
News TradingAllowed — no restrictions on futures news tradingRestricted on funded accounts during major releases
PlatformsNinjaTrader, Tradovate (Rithmic-based)NinjaTrader, Tradovate, TradingView, Quantower
Payout ScheduleOn demand after 5 qualifying days — 1-3 business days processingNear-instant; typically 1–2 BD processing
